Getting to know Puerto Salgar

Puerto Salgar is a small town located in the Cundinamarca Department of Colombia. Situated along the Magdalena River, it serves as an important transportation and trade hub in the region. With a population of around 30,000 people, Puerto Salgar offers a serene and picturesque setting with its stunning landscapes and charming architecture.

The town is known for its rich history and cultural heritage. Visitors can explore the many historical sites and landmarks, such as the beautiful San Sebastián Church and the Casa de la Cultura, which showcases local art and folklore. The town also hosts various festivals and events throughout the year, providing a vibrant and lively atmosphere for both locals and tourists.

Puerto Salgar is also a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ts. The surrounding natural landscapes offer numerous opportunities for adventure and exploration. Visitors can enjoy activities such as hiking, bird watching, and boat tours along the Magdalena River. The town is also close to several national parks, including the Los Nevados National Natural Park and the Chicaque Natural Park, where visitors can immerse themselves in the beauty of Colombia's diverse flora and fauna.
